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
98848010848 903366 673243 272992446
0301638 48158514
0301638 48158514
4103149174 992414 51356
All about undefined
Interested in learning more?
0301638 48158514
4103149174 992414 51356
See more
13715224 905631825 17
17233903 97874491 15324 070470133 807
See more
46959384630 995673712
012323646 023 862200
See more